I was pleasantly surprised. Beautiful color, sweet smell. Both are impressive, featuring delicate, mellow flavors- smooth and well-balanced with floral, sweet notes. Mellow but richer than Shinokaze. Lovely taste - umami and seaweedy, minimal bitterness and astringency, slightly floral, savory, quite smooth- melts in the mouth! Good everyday balanced matcha! Sweet, slight bitterness and astringency, and slightly floral. Tastes like a flower garden in my mouth in the best way! There is a slight but not unpleasant bitterness as an usucha. Smooth, creamy, mellow. Flavor disappears easily so I enjoy it best in more concentrated ratios. I find this to be a very reasonable price for the quality of matcha powder. I recommend both Kouun no Shiro and Shinokaze no Shiro to beginners or anyone seeking everyday “bang-for-your-buck” matcha powders!

Premium ceremonial grade matcha from Takenakaen Sashichi, a brand with over 150 years of devotion to honest, quality Japanese tea. Master tea artisans blend the finest tencha and stone-mill into ultra-fine powder.
